Alachisoft
16 Case Studies
A Alachisoft Case Study
Moonpig, the online greeting‑card retailer experiencing rapid growth across the UK, Australia and the US, faced scaling and high‑availability problems with ASP.NET session state: InProc and SQLServer session stores could not cope with multi‑server web farms or peak loads. To solve this, Moonpig turned to Alachisoft and deployed NCache to provide reliable, scalable session storage.
Alachisoft’s NCache—an in‑memory distributed cache—was implemented to hold ASP.NET sessions in a replicated, high‑availability cache. NCache eliminated session loss during server maintenance, enabled simple round‑robin load balancing, and let Moonpig scale by adding cache servers as needed; Moonpig now runs six web servers against two NCache servers with “no discernable delay” in session loads and plans to expand NCache use into order processing.
Jay Jetley
Systems Architect